Feel free to comment and provide any feedback too! ###[Twitter](https://twitter.com/Giga_Penguin) ###[Instagram](https://www.instagram.com/GigaPenguin3DPrinting/) Description ==================== A base for Hotwheels Ford RS200 Team Transport set, it should work with only work with any set that share the same van and trailer. Hopefully more sets will come with this setup in the future. The display base is separated into 3 parts, name plate, the base and the back plate. "BoxBackAssem" Variants ==================== There are 4 variants of "BoxBackAssem" in this, the one in my pictures are "BoxBackAssem". The difference for each "BoxBackAssem are: ###BoxBackAssem: "FIA WRC" logo on the left side is slightly editted to make it easier to print the "Championship" letterings with 0.4mm nozzle. ###BoxBackAssemV2: "FIA WRC" logo on the left side has been moved slightly more to the left, the van is a little too close to the edge of the "FIA WRC" logo. Also share the same slightly editted "FIA WRC" logo like in "BoxBackAssem". ###BoxBackAssemOriginal: Similar to "BoxBackAssem" but the "FIA WRC" logo is in its original form. The "FIA WRC" logo will require 0.2mm nozzle to print out the "Championship" letters. ###BoxBackAssemV2Original: Similar to "BoxBackAssemV2" but the "FIA WRC" logo is in its original form. The "FIA WRC" logo will require 0.2mm nozzle to print out the "Championship" letters. Print Settings ==================== Nozzle size = 0.4 mm (minimum, smaller better) Layer height = 0.2 mm Filament change layer for colours on backplate: 1) Layer 19 (Stripe, Ford logo background and "RS200" logo colours, mine is blue) 2) Layer 24 ("Ford" lettering and oval ring on Ford logo, mine is white) 3) Layer 29 ("FIA World Rally Championship" lettering, mine is silver) Filament change layer for colours on name plate: 1) Layer 6 (Ford logo background and "RS200" logo colours, mine is blue) 2) Layer 11 ("Ford" lettering, outer ring on Ford logo and "Race Team" lettering, mine is white) Colours ==================== Colours of all other items is your choice. Assembly ==================== The car is tied with metal wire through the display base holes, the wire will need to be slide between the wheels and the metal body. The Ford RS200 is tied by wires through the trailer as shown in one of the pictures above. Back plate should slide in nicely into the display base. The name plate might need some trimming to the side to fit into the box.
